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3
The NM_019609.5(CPXM1):c.1646G>A(p.Arg549Gln)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000806 in 1,613,870 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R549L) has been classified as Uncertain significance.

The c.1646G>A (p.R549Q) alteration is located in exon 11 (coding exon 11) of the CPXM1 gene. This alteration results from a G to A substitution at nucleotide position 1646, causing the arginine (R) at amino acid position 549 to be replaced by a glutamine (Q).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
